Holding Focus Sash
Jolly, max EVs on attack and speed.
-Fake out
-Foul Play
-Hypnosis
-U-Turn
Send it out as a lead and watch the fun begin. A lot of times you can easily score a hypnosis hit or a couple of Foul Plays after a fake out, simply because they don't expect it and they decide to buff their current Pokemon instead of just taking you out. If it's something that is weak to dark, or has a crazy high attack, you can net a 1 or 2HKO easily. If not, U-turn out and come back later to screw with someone else.
Back when physical Aegislash was all the rage, Meowth was my go-to counter, simply because he was never perceived as a threat, and they'd leave themselves wide open.
